Matt tried to read the acquisition proposals Krish, his CTO, had sent him before finally giving up. His morning run and workout did nothing to help clear his mind, and he wondered if he had misjudged Ollie’s feelings for him. His heart felt funny and he couldn’t catch his breath. After lunch, there was a key in the door and Matt stood expectantly as Finn emerged from the hallway. He sighed unhappily, his body sagging.

“Hey, babe,” Finn said softly, scanning Matt’s face. “Wanna talk about it?” He scratched his head in embarrassment. “I got jealous and behaved like an idiot.” Finn frowned. “You? What did you imagine you saw?” “Why do you assume I imagined something?” Matt asked irritatedly. Finn made a face. “Because Ollie isn’t like that, because Ollie loves you, and because he only has eyes for you.

Those are the top three reasons, but there are a million more.” “I thought I saw him give his number to a guy yesterday.” Finn opened her mouth and rolled her eyes. “He looked flirty, and gorgeous, and the guy was staring at him,” Matt added defensively. “Everybody stares at him, because he is gorgeous. They do it to you too!” She punched his bicep lightly with a laugh.

“You have nothing to worry about. Unless you said or did something stupid last night.” She tilted her head. “Did you?” Matt slid his glance away. “I don’t know. He’s not responding.” He looked back at Finn. “And, I don’t even know where my boyfriend lives.” Finn smiled. “I do.” Matt waited outside Ollie’s place for nearly an hour after ringing the bell and getting no answer. Finally, he saw Ollie come around the corner with his backpack slung over his left shoulder. Matt watched his step falter momentarily as their eyes met, before he continued walking with a guarded expression.

Matt smiled nervously; his stomach filled with uncertainty as Ollie stopped in front of him. “Hey. You still mad at me?” Matt asked quietly. “I should be,” Ollie scoffed. He looked over his shoulder at the door to his flat. “I have a football match in a bit. I need to get changed and eat something. Wanna come in for a minute?” Matt hesitated. “No one’s home, nor will they be.

You can stay in the living room if you’d like,” Ollie added derisively as he unlocked the door. Matt flinched at Ollie’s tone and followed him into a moderately tidy living area, with a large dining table and some worn-looking couches in front of a sliding glass door that opened onto a small garden with plastic chairs.

The kitchen sink was full of dirty dishes, with more on the surrounding counters and Matt fought a grimace.
